Exploring different design styles is crucial when creating a letter G circle logo. The style you choose will communicate your brand's personality and values. From minimalist to abstract, each style offers unique possibilities for incorporating the letter 'G' within a circle.
Minimalist
Minimalist logos are clean, simple, and effective. For a 'G' circle logo, this style focuses on essential elements, using clean lines and ample whitespace. A minimalist 'G' circle logo often conveys sophistication, modernity, and clarity.
Geometric
Geometric designs are based on shapes like circles, squares, and triangles. A 'G' circle logo naturally lends itself to a geometric style. This approach uses precise lines and shapes to create a structured and balanced logo, projecting stability and order.
Abstract
Abstract logos use non-representational forms to convey a brand's essence. An abstract 'G' circle logo can be highly creative, using stylized 'G' shapes or incorporating elements that subtly suggest 'G' within the circular form. This style is excellent for brands seeking to be unique and memorable.
Modern
Modern logo design trends often favor clean lines, bold colors, and simplified forms. A modern 'G' circle logo will likely incorporate current design aesthetics, ensuring the logo looks fresh and relevant. This style often appeals to contemporary audiences and tech-focused businesses.
Classic
Classic logos are timeless and enduring. A classic 'G' circle logo might use traditional fonts for the 'G' or incorporate subtle serif elements, maintaining a sense of heritage and reliability. This style is suitable for established brands wanting to project trustworthiness and longevity.
Color Palettes
Color is a powerful tool in logo design. The colors you choose for your 'G' circle logo will evoke specific emotions and associations. Consider your brand's personality and target audience when selecting a color palette. Different color combinations can drastically change the logo's perception.
Monochromatic
Using a monochromatic color scheme, which involves different shades of a single color, can create a sophisticated and unified 'G' circle logo. This approach is simple yet elegant, conveying professionalism and refinement.
Gradient
Gradients, or color transitions, can add depth and visual interest to a 'G' circle logo. A gradient within the 'G' or the circle can make the logo more dynamic and eye-catching, suggesting innovation and modernity.
Bold Colors
Using bold and vibrant colors for your 'G' circle logo can make it stand out and grab attention. Bright reds, blues, or yellows can convey energy, excitement, and confidence, making your brand memorable and impactful.
Neutral Colors
Neutral color palettes, such as grays, beiges, and whites, offer a sense of sophistication, elegance, and reliability. A 'G' circle logo in neutral colors can project a calm and trustworthy image, ideal for professional services or luxury brands.
Brand Colors
Integrating your established brand colors into your 'G' circle logo ensures brand consistency and recognition. If your brand already has strong color associations, leveraging these in your logo will reinforce brand identity and recall.
Letter G Variations
The way you design the letter 'G' within the circle is crucial. There are numerous ways to stylize the 'G' to create different visual effects and convey various brand attributes. Experiment with different forms of 'G' to find the perfect fit for your logo.
Uppercase 'G'
Using an uppercase 'G' often conveys authority, strength, and professionalism. A bold uppercase 'G' in a circle can create a strong and impactful logo, suitable for corporate or established businesses.
Lowercase 'g'
A lowercase 'g' can appear more approachable, friendly, and modern. A lowercase 'g' circle logo can be suitable for brands aiming for a more casual or personal feel, especially in tech or creative industries.
Stylized 'G'
Creating a stylized or unique 'G' can make your logo stand out. This could involve modifying the letter's shape, adding subtle curves, or incorporating elements that reflect your brand's industry or values. A stylized 'G' adds personality and memorability.
Serif 'G'
Using a serif font for the 'G' can give your logo a classic, traditional, and elegant feel. Serif fonts are often associated with history, trustworthiness, and high quality, suitable for brands seeking to project these qualities.
Sans-Serif 'G'
A sans-serif 'G' provides a clean, modern, and versatile look. Sans-serif fonts are generally more readable and contemporary, making them a popular choice for modern 'G' circle logos aiming for simplicity and clarity.
Circle Integration
The circle is not just a container; it's an integral part of the logo. How the 'G' interacts with the circle impacts the overall design. Consider different ways to integrate the 'G' within the circle to achieve the desired visual effect.
'G' Inside the Circle
Placing the 'G' entirely inside the circle is a classic and straightforward approach. This creates a contained and balanced logo, emphasizing unity and completeness. It's a versatile and easily recognizable design.
'G' as Part of the Circle
Designing the 'G' to form part of the circle itself can create a seamless and integrated design. This approach can be more abstract and visually interesting, suggesting fluidity and connection.
Negative Space 'G'
Using negative space to create the 'G' within the circle is a clever and sophisticated technique. The 'G' is formed by the empty space around other elements, often creating a hidden or surprise element that enhances memorability.
'G' Overlapping the Circle
Allowing the 'G' to slightly overlap or extend beyond the circle can add dynamism and break the monotony of a perfectly contained design. This can suggest growth, expansion, or breaking boundaries.
Line Art Circle 'G'
Creating the 'G' and the circle using only lines results in a clean, modern, and versatile logo. Line art logos are scalable and work well in various applications, offering simplicity and elegance.
